These options were used to configure the built-in JRE SSL libraries when downloading files from HTTPS servers. But because they were also used to set up the now (long) removed internal HTTPS file server, their default configuration chose convenience over security by having overly lenient settings. This change removes the configuration options that affect the JRE SSL libraries. The JRE trust store can still be configured via system properties (or globally in the JRE security config). The only lost functionality is not being able to disable the default hostname verifier when using spark-submit, which should be fine since Spark itself is not using https for any internal functionality anymore.
